Инструменты - Генератор JSON-LD
Онлайн-генератор JSON-LD: BlogPosting, FAQPage, BreadcrumbList, Organization, WebSite, SoftwareApplication и другие типы schema.org — с копированием и тегом script.
Версия · обновлено 22 мая 2026 г.
Параметры
Выберите тип schema.org и заполните поля — JSON-LD обновится автоматически. Несколько блоков объединяются в массив.
Подставьте типовую разметку — затем отредактируйте поля под свой сайт.
Блок 1
Публикация блога с автором, датой и изображением.
Результат
Готовый JSON-LD для вставки на страницу. Проверьте разметку в Rich Results Test или валидаторе Яндекса
<script type="application/ld+json">{ "@context": "https://schema.org", "@type": "BlogPosting", "name": "Заголовок статьи", "headline": "Заголовок статьи", "description": "Краткое описание для поисковиков", "datePublished": "2026-05-22T12:00:00.000Z", "author": { "@type": "Person", "name": "Иван Иванов", "url": "https://example.com/about" }, "image": [ "https://example.com/assets/cover.webp" ], "mainEntityOfPage": { "@type": "WebPage", "@id": "https://example.com/posts/my-post" }, "inLanguage": "ru-RU"}</script>Расскажите о вашем проекте
Связаться иначе
- Почта
- hello@baranov.guru
- Telegram
- @baranov_guru
- Чат на сайте
- Написать
Часто задаваемые вопросы
JSON-LD — формат структурированных данных schema.org в виде JSON внутри страницы (часто в теге script type="application/ld+json"). Поисковики используют его, чтобы понять тип контента: статья, FAQ, хлебные крошки, приложение и т.д. Это дополняет sitemap и robots.txt, а не заменяет их.
BlogPosting, CreativeWork, FAQPage, BreadcrumbList, Organization, WebSite, WebPage, Service, SoftwareApplication и VideoObject — те же семейства типов, что часто встречаются на сайтах и в блогах. Можно добавить несколько блоков разметки на одну страницу (массив объектов).
Никуда на сервер: JSON-LD собирается в браузере при каждом изменении формы. Копирование — через буфер обмена, как в других инструментах на сайте.
Отформатированный JSON (один объект или массив) и вариант с обёрткой script type="application/ld+json" для вставки в HTML или компонент страницы Next.js.
Да: сверьте разметку с Rich Results Test или валидатором Яндекса. Генератор не заменяет ручную проверку всех обязательных полей конкретного типа в документации Google и schema.org.
Можно обсудить расширение генератора под ваши шаблоны страниц или API.
Вам может быть интересно

Валидатор JSON-LD
Проверка JSON-LD по URL страницы: извлечение блоков разметки, типы schema.org и замечания по обязательным полям.

JSON-LD для сайта: как структурированные данные помогают SEO и бизнесу
Разбираемся, что такое JSON-LD, почему структурированные данные важны для SEO, какие типы разметки нужны бизнес-сайту и как проверить, что поисковые системы понимают страницы правильно.

Добавляем JSON-LD разметку к блогу на Next.js
Инструкция по добавлению JSON-LD разметки к блогу на Next.js...

Техническая SEO-оптимизация сайта
Находим и исправляем технические ограничения, которые мешают поисковикам обходить, индексировать и ранжировать важные страницы сайта.

Frontend разработка
Разрабатываем интерфейсы, которые быстро работают, удобно используются и масштабируются вместе с продуктом.

Sitemap.xml для сайта: что это, зачем нужен и как не допустить ошибок
Разбираемся, что такое sitemap.xml, когда карта сайта действительно нужна бизнесу, какие страницы должны в нее попадать и как проверить, что она помогает индексации, а не отправляет поисковиков в технический мусор.

Генератор sitemap.xml
Соберите валидный sitemap.xml из списка URL: обычная карта, индекс или расширения Google (image, video, news) — прямо в браузере.

Robots.txt для сайта: что это, зачем нужен и как не закрыть важные страницы от поиска
Разбираемся, что такое robots.txt, как он влияет на обход сайта, почему не подходит для скрытия страниц из поиска и какие ошибки могут стоить бизнесу органического трафика.

Генератор robots.txt
Соберите robots.txt для сайта: группы с одним user-agent, Allow/Disallow, Clean-param для Яндекса и Sitemap — прямо в браузере.